VERSABANK WELCOMES BACK FINANCING INDUSTRY VETERAN MOE DANIS TO SUPPORT ANTICIPATED GROWTH OF REAL-TIME SRP
VersaBank has added point-of-sale financing industry veteran Moe Danis, CFA, to the bank's structured receivable program (SRP) team to support business development in response to increased demand following the bank's launch of its real-time SRP, with a particular focus on specialized large-partner opportunities in the United States market.

Mr. Danis has nearly five decades of experience as a leader and innovator in the banking and lease and finance industries. In addition to being a highly sought after consultant, including to point-of-sale financing companies and his previous tenure at VersaBank, Mr. Danis's experience includes serving as senior vice-president, program finance, at CWB Maxium Financial Inc. and managing director, lease finance, private fixed income, at SunLife.
Since the late 1980s, Mr. Danis has been a leader and innovator in the private securitization market in Canada. He has experienced the complete business and credit life cycle through the lens of several of Canada's leaders of portfolio finance facilities. His ability to understand the demands of a highly regulated institutional environment allows him to create and structure attractive finance programs for all sizes of originators. Mr. Danis has served as a board member to a number of independent leasing companies and the Canadian Finance and Leasing Association.
ABOUT VersaBank
VersaBank is a North American bank with a difference. Federally chartered in both Canada and the United States, VersaBank has a branchless, digital, business-to-business model based on its proprietary state-of-the-art technology that enables it to profitably address underserved segments of the banking industry in a significantly risk mitigated manner. Because VersaBank obtains substantially all of its deposits and undertakes the majority of its funding activities electronically through financial intermediary partners, it benefits from significant operating leverage that drives efficiency and return on common equity. In August, 2024, VersaBank launched its unique structured receivable program funding solution for point-of-sale finance companies, which has been highly successful in Canada for over 15 years, to the underserved multitrillion-dollar United States market. VersaBank also owns Minnesota-based DRT Cyber Inc., a North American leader in the provision of cybersecurity services to address the rapidly growing volume of cyber threats challenging financial institutions, multinational corporations and government entities. Through DRT Cyber Inc., VersaBank owns proprietary intellectual property and technology to enable the next generation of digital assets for the banking and financial community, including the bank's revolutionary and proprietary Real Bank Tokenized Deposits.
